Output 764b0be1a13ad75b327aae06e89c080cac5086752750eb6758e277b751e63b76:1

value
105000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58307e1362fab95809946c4627e94f6848181c3d OP_EQUAL
address
39jKUjy8TRoFV67Y8wtvvoQv42PAuYLfiz
transaction
764b0be1a13ad75b327aae06e89c080cac5086752750eb6758e277b751e63b76
confirmations
498977
spent
true